Luke Combs reflected on the moment he received his first guitar.
The country megastar posted two photos of himself at 9 years old on Instagram on Wednesday evening (December 10). He said his mother “came across these gems,” while looking at old photos. Combs, now 35, received the guitar for Christmas in 1999. He wrote in his caption: “My mom was going through some old photos the other day and came across these gems haha. This was Christmas 1999, I was 9 years old and my parents had just given me my first guitar. Crazy how life changes because for many years after these photos were taken I had no interest at all in that guitar.”
Combs is getting ready to introduce the next chapter in his career. Most recently, the singer-songwriter debuted “Giving Her Away,” an emotional ballad that serves as a letter from a groom to his father-in-law. Before that, he delivered “Back in the Saddle” and The Prequel, a 3-track project that includes “My Kinda Saturday Night,” “15 Minutes” and “Days Like These.” Combs will kick off his headlining “My Kinda Saturday Night Tour” in 2026. Special guests Dierks Bentley, The Script, The Teskey Brothers, Thomas Rhett, Ty Myers, Jake Worthington, Thelma & James and The Castellows are set to join the tour on select dates. Combs’ latest studio album is Fathers & Sons, a tribute to his life with his family. He and his wife, Nicole Combs, welcomed firstborn son Tex Lawrence Combs in June 2022. Baby No. 2, son Beau Lee Combs, followed in August 2023. Earlier this year, they announced Nicole is pregnant with Baby No. 3.
